Edward Lawton Obituary

Edward John Lawton, 87, of Salida died March 17, 2019, at his home.

He was born Aug. 16, 1931, in North Adams, Massachusetts, to Edward John Lawton and Evelyn Dehey Lawton.

He received degrees from North Adams State College and Fairfield University and a doctorate of education from the University of Virginia.

As a three-sport athlete, he played football, basketball and baseball. His baseball talents were rewarded with a pro contract with the Philadelphia Phillies.

However, that dream was interrupted by enlistment in the U.S. Army and service in the Korean War. He remained an avid lifelong sports fan.

Dr. Lawton pursued a career in education and taught at the University of New Hampshire and the College of Charleston in South Carolina.

He retired as a distinguished professor from the School of Education at the College of Charleston in 1998.

He and his wife, Marilyn, made their home in Salida in 2010 to be closer to family, and they enjoyed the small friendly town.

Dr. Lawton was preceded in death by his son Richard Warren Lawton in 1998.

Survivors include his wife of 63 years; son Mark Edward Lawton (Lucinda Katz Lawton) of Howard; daughter, Nancy Lawton Eddy (Tom Pokorny) of Salida; granddaughter, Melanie Katz-Lawton of Denver; and brother, Richard Austin (Marguerite) Lawton of New London, New Hampshire.

A burial of his ashes will take place in the family plot in Gardener, Massachusetts.
